I tested my C+P a month ago and got 3 reps with 2x20K. That was after completing 1.1 with 2x16K. 1.1 was already too taxing after I started ramping up my weekly running mileage, so 1.2 was not an option.

Instead, I started a 3.0 cycle with a push-press as a last rep in every set... including push-press singles on Day 3 of each week. I also stopped chasing the clock so my session volume was in the 20-40 range. Moreover I slightly stretched my Giant weeks to 8-days to accommodate my runs.

Still... I tested my C+P this morning, at the end of Week 3, and got a solid 5RM!!!

I'll still finish Week 4, before I restart 3.0 with strict C+P. I'm still hopeful to reach my end of year goal of pressing a pair of 24s, while still on track with my running goals.

More progress! I was very surprised today, I’m currently on my rest/fun training week of the Giant. I was running it with 24s (Giant 1.0, 1.1). I planned to move up to 28s and thought I’d have to run 3.0. But I decided to test my Rep max with the 28s. Now, 4 months ago I could do maybe 2 CP with 28s and they were sketchy. Having only worked with 24s I was surprised how light they 28s felt. I banged out 10 no problem! Stoked! I’ll be running 1.0 with them next week. And I smell some double 32s in my future.



I have proof lol

One side note, after taking these rest days serious I felt so damn powerful today! I love how this program works you hard but also makes you feel strong!
